JERRY E HARRELL
MARCH 29, 1935 – FEBRUARY 1, 2012
Jerry Eugene Harrell, 76, of Athens, GA passed away Wednesday, February 1, 2012.
A native of Tuscaloosa, Alabama, Mr. Harrell was the son of the late D.W. Harrell and Ruby Nell Cook Harrell and was preceded in death by a son, Jerry Daniel Harrell and sister, Elizabeth Ruth Ashcraft. He had worked for Gulf State Paper Company is Tuscaloosa and retired from Reliance Electric in Athens. Mr. Harrell was also a member of Alberta Baptist Church in Tuscaloosa.
Survivors include his wife, Nancy Wheelis Harrell of Athens; son, Russell Lee Harrell of Anderson, SC; grandchildren, Justin Harrell, Ben Harrell, Parker Harrell, Chelsea Harrell, Clara Harrell, and Nick Harrell, and great-granddaughter, Abby Harrell.
Graveside services will be held 2PM Saturday, February 4th at Evergreen Memorial Park with Clint Adams officiating. The family will receive friends from 12-2PM prior to the service at Bernstein Funeral Home.
The grandchildren will serve as pallbearers.
In lieu of flowers, the family requests that donations be made to Odyssey Hospice, 575 Research Dr, Athens, GA 30605.
